Volunteers needed for Ecuador Cloud Forest Bird Expedition
Las Tangaras Reserve, Andes Mountains, South America
August 15 - 28, 2010

Become a Life Net Volunteer! Join Dr. Dusti Becker for an exciting 2-week conservation experience in the Andes of western Ecuador. Dr. Becker, a well-known tropical avian ecologist with over 15 years of experience in Ecuador, will lead the expedition with help from experienced Ecuadorian field assistants. Volunteers help collect data about birds at Las Tangaras Reserve near Mindo, Ecuador to advance scientific understanding of cloud forest avian community structure and bird species tolerances for deforestation and grazing. The volunteer contribution of $1500 to the project via non-profit conservation organization Life Net is tax deductible.

Las Tangaras is home to more than 20 species of hummingbirds and a cock-of-the-rock arena, so the ecology of these exciting birds is another focus of research and conservation. Volunteers help set up and monitor mist nets, extract birds from nets, carry birds from nets to a banding station, and record basic ecological data. Bilingual volunteers may contribute to environmental education and ecotourism training at Las Tangaras. Volunteers will have some afternoons free to explore and bird the Mindo area.

Volunteer contribution covers transportation within Ecuador, room, & meals during the project. The expedition begins and ends in Quito. Must be over 18 years of age to participate. For further details, contact Dusti Becker: dbecker@lifenetnature.org
